Longevity App - Project Overview

🎯 Mission

Build a production-ready health tracking system optimized for longevity, with a laser focus on the #1 behavioral metric: Never go more than 2 days without activity.

This is your accountability mechanism for the next 65 years.


🏗️ Architecture

Tech Stack

Backend:

  • Python 3.10+
  • FastAPI (REST API)
  • SQLAlchemy (ORM)
  • SQLite (Database)
  • garminconnect (Unofficial Garmin API)

Frontend:

  • React 18
  • React Router (Navigation)
  • Recharts (Data Visualization)
  • Axios (API Client)

Deployment:

  • Local-first (no cloud dependencies)
  • Mobile-responsive web interface
  • All data owned by user

🎯 Key Features

1. Activity Gap Alert (CRITICAL)

Location: Command Center (home page) Purpose: Make it PAINFUL to see >2 days since last activity

Logic:

gap = (now - last_activity.start_time).days

if gap < 1.5:
    alert = "GREEN""✓ ACTIVE"
elif gap < 2.0:
    alert = "YELLOW""⚠ REST DAY ENDING"
else:
    alert = "RED""🚨 GET MOVING NOW!"

Visual Design:

  • Green: Subtle border, small font
  • Yellow: Warning colors, larger font
  • Red: HUGE text, pulsing animation, impossible to ignore

2. Activity Streak Counter

Location: Command Center Purpose: Gamification + motivation

Logic:

streak = 0
for activity in reversed(activities):
    if days_since_previous <= 2.0:
        streak += 1
    else:
        break  # Streak broken

Milestones (with celebration animations):

  • 7 days: "Great start! ✨"
  • 14 days: "Two weeks! 🔥"
  • 30 days: "One month! 🔥🔥"
  • 60 days: "Unstoppable! 🔥🔥🔥"
  • 90 days: "This is your lifestyle now! ⚡"
  • 180 days: "Medicine 3.0 Champion! 💎"
  • 365 days: "You are immortal! 🏆"

3. Auto Activity Classification

Location: Backend service Purpose: Automatically categorize activities based on HR + duration

Classification Logic:

def classify_activity(activity):
    if activity.source == 'crossfit':
        return 'strength'

    if 'strength' in activity.activity_type:
        return 'strength'

    if activity.activity_type in ['cycling', 'running']:
        # Zone 2: 40+ min, HR 120-140
        if duration >= 40 and 120 <= avg_hr <= 140:
            return 'zone2'

        # VO2 Max: 25-50 min, HR >170
        if 25 <= duration <= 50 and avg_hr >= 170:
            return 'vo2max'

    return 'other'

4. Weekly Target Tracking

Location: Weekly Log page Purpose: Show progress toward longevity-focused targets

Targets:

  • Zone 2: 3-4 sessions/week ✅
  • Strength: 3 sessions/week ✅
  • VO2 Max: 1 session/week ✅
  • No gaps >2 days ✅
  • Steps: 8000+/day avg ✅

Perfect Week = All targets met!

5. Calendar Heatmap

Location: Calendar page Purpose: Visual consistency tracker (like GitHub contributions)

Color Coding:

  • 🟢 Green: Activity logged
  • ⚪ Gray: No activity (shame!)

Psychology: Seeing a long streak of green squares is HIGHLY motivating.

🎓 Key Learnings from Medicine 3.0

Exercise Framework (Peter Attia)

  1. Zone 2 Training (3-4 sessions/week, 45-60min each)

    • Builds mitochondrial density
    • Improves fat oxidation
    • Foundation of aerobic fitness
    • Target: Conversational pace, HR 120-140
  2. VO2 Max Training (1 session/week, 25-50min)

    • Improves peak cardiovascular capacity
    • Strongest predictor of longevity
    • Target: 85-95% max HR
    • Format: 4-8 minute intervals
  3. Strength Training (3 sessions/week)

    • Prevents sarcopenia (muscle loss)
    • Bone density (prevents osteoporosis)
    • Functional fitness (carry groceries at 90!)
    • Focus: Compound movements, progressive overload
  4. Stability (daily)

    • Balance, proprioception
    • Prevents falls (leading cause of death in elderly)
    • Improves movement quality

Key Biomarkers

  1. ApoB (<60 mg/dL)

    • Best predictor of atherosclerotic disease
    • Better than LDL cholesterol
  2. HbA1c (<5.2%)

    • Glucose control
    • Diabetes risk
  3. VO2 Max (top 20% for age)

    • Single best predictor of all-cause mortality
    • Higher = longer healthspan
  4. Resting Heart Rate (<60 bpm)

    • Cardiovascular fitness indicator
    • Lower = better
  5. HRV (higher is better)

    • Autonomic nervous system health
    • Recovery indicator
